Insurance and financial institutions operate core systems based on outdated technologies, such as COBOL. These environments are deeply embedded, costly to maintain and complex to migrate.
Balancing modernization, compliance and continuity is a critical challenge for CIOs and transformation leads. We address this specific issue with a vertical, structured approach built for regulated, legacy-dependent sectors.

Captures real transaction messages over time from production systems to replicate business behavior during migration validation, enhancing reliability and reducing testing effort through accurate, real-world data simulation.
Replays captured transactions on the new architecture to ensure consistent business output, enabling functional validation and reducing reliance on large QA teams through automated, real-world scenario testing.
Automatically compares source and target outputs from re-executed transactions, highlighting data or behavior discrepancies to accelerate defect detection, support quicker resolution, and build confidence in system accuracy ahead of Go-Live.
Extracts files and objects from both distributed and mainframe environments using Linux-based templates, ensuring complete and reliable access to all necessary data required for a successful and comprehensive migration process.
Performs automated, in-depth code analysis to assess migration complexity, estimate effort, and detect dependencies across insurance systems, enabling early risk mitigation and better-informed planning decisions.
Allows flexible setup of file types and characteristics, adapting to insurance-specific data formats and structures. This ensures accurate data handling and integrity throughout migration, reducing errors and supporting reliable transformation outcomes.
Supports flexible file configuration and automated format and encoding conversion, tailored to insurance data. Ensures accurate, secure data handling during migration while reducing manual effort and preventing data loss.
Automatically generates catalogues of application components and data, streamlining inventory management and enabling full traceability and control throughout all phases of the migration process.
